## 2.8.0 — Renamed setting

`TENANT_RATE_CAP` is now `TENANT_QUOTA_RPS` in Meterline. Old name removed; no fallback. Plugin authors must update manifests before 2.8.0 or quota checks fail closed. Per-tenant overrides still live in `quotas.d/`. The quota sync worker also needs its broker credential in the env file, added on the following line:

sealed setting: VAULT_KEY20=c8ea1e419912889df6b4

**CI note: parcel webhook tests flaking again**

Quick heads-up for the sync: the Lorryline parcel-tracking webhook suite keeps flaking on CI because the mock carrier server sometimes boots slower than the 2s timeout. Tomas bumped it to 5s and the pass rate went back to normal, but we should really make the harness wait on readiness instead of sleeping. Not blocking the release, just annoying. The last green run's trace token is pasted below for reference.

pipeline stamp: htk31_f769b577b3028a4e9958e5bb8d1259a

### CI note: SQL lint flakes on Bramblewick pipelines

If the SQL linter fails only in CI, it's usually the dialect flag — local defaults to the Penhallow dialect, CI doesn't. Pin it in the repo config instead of fixing files. If that still fails, compare against the last green run, whose build token is recorded below.

pipeline stamp: htk3_69f

Leadership Review Briefing — Marketing Budget Reduction. For the finance team: the proposed 18% cut to the Brightmoor Division marketing budget reflects softer demand for the Cadenza product line and a deliberate shift toward retention spending. Paid media absorbs most of the reduction; events and sponsorships are trimmed selectively. We have modeled pipeline impact under three scenarios and flagged risks to the Arlenfield launch. Context on how this fits the wider business plan follows below.

management briefing: Goroxix Systems is in early talks to buy Kelethek Holdings for about $118.0 million. The Sileth launch date is February 25, and nothing goes to the press before then. Legal wants the Pelokox Logistics term sheet withdrawn before December 14.